html, body, div, h1, h2, h3, h4, h5, h6, ul, ol, dl, li, dt, dd, p, blockquote, pre, form, fieldset, table, th, td { margin: 0; padding: 0; }

body {background:url(images/global/bg.jpg) top center no-repeat; width:100%; background-color:#000; font-family:Arial, sans-serif; color:#4d4d4d; font-size:12px; line-height:22px;}

.left { float:left; padding-bottom: 15px; padding-right: 25px;}
.right { float:right; padding-bottom: 15px; padding-left: 25px;}
.clear { clear:both;}

.pdf {float:left; padding-right:20px;}
.copy { float:right; padding-top:20px;}

#social {float:right; padding-top:50px; padding-right:35px;}
.social { float:left; padding-right:12px;}

#share {float:left; width:900px;}
#share li {list-style-type:none; float:left;}

.blue {color:#003f66;}

.plus {padding-left:13px;}

.list {margin-top:10px;}
.bullet {margin-left:15px;}

.label {font-size: 14px;}
.error {font-size: 16px; color:#d80505;}

img {border:none;}
a {color:#000; text-decoration:underline; font-weight:bold; outline:none;}
p {padding: 10px 0px 0px 0px;}

h1 {color:#4d4d4d; font-size: 18px; margin-bottom:20px;}
h2 {color:#1e2326; font-size: 16px;}
h3 {color:#13405b; font-size: 14px;}
h3 a {color:#13405b;}

.headline {color:#fff; font-size: 16px; float:right; padding-top:50px; padding-right:25px;}
.headline a {color:#fff; text-decoration:underline;}

#wrapper{width:1024px; margin:0 auto;}

#logo { width: 980px; height:75px; margin:0 auto; padding-top:15px;}

#header {width:1024px; margin:0 auto;}

#container { background:url(images/global/container.png) repeat-y; margin:0 auto; width: 1024px;}
#content { width: 930px; margin:0 auto; padding: 0px 15px 0px 15px;}

#top {float:left; width:930px; color:#4d4d4d; margin-top:10px;}

#leftcol {float: left; width:280px; padding-right:20px; margin-top:10px; }
#centercol {float: left; width: 280px; padding-left:20px; padding-right:17px; margin-top:10px; border-left:1px solid #f2f0e6; border-right:1px solid #f2f0e6; }
#rightcol {float:left; width: 280px; padding-left:17px; margin-top:10px;}

#left {float: left; width: 280px; padding-right:25px; margin-top:30px; }
#right-wide {float: left; width: 600px; margin-top:30px; padding-left:14px; border-left:1px solid #f2f0e6;}

#left-wide {float: left; width: 600px; padding-right:28px; margin-top:20px; }
#right{float: left; width: 300px; margin-top:10px;}

#matrixray-left {float: left; width: 250px; padding-right:5px; margin-top:30px;}
#matrixray-right-wide {float:left; width: 650px; margin-top:30px; padding-left:10px; border-left:1px solid #f2f0e6;}

#head { background:url(images/global/header.png); width:960px; height: 15px; margin:0 auto; position:relative; clear:both;}
#m-head { background:url(images/global/m-header.png); width:960px; height: 25px; margin:0 auto; position:relative; clear:both;}
#footer { background:url(images/global/footer.png); width:960px; height: 25px; margin:0 auto; position:relative; font-family:Arial, sans-serif; font-size:12px;}

#bg {width:1024px; margin:0 auto;}
#bg2 { background:url(images/global/bg2.jpg); width:1024px; height: 146px; margin:0 auto;}

#grey-top { background:url(images/global/grey-top.png) no-repeat; width: 300px; height:11px;}
#grey { background-color:#f8f8f8; width:264px; margin-left:2px; padding-top:8px; padding-left:15px; padding-bottom:8px; padding-right:15px; border-left:1px solid #ddd; border-right:1px solid #ddd;}
#grey-bottom { background:url(images/global/grey-bottom.png) no-repeat; width: 300px; height:11px; margin-bottom:10px;}

#software-btns { height:90px; border-bottom:1px solid #f2f0e6;}
.btn { float:left; margin-right:44px;}
.btn-last { float:left; margin-right:0px;}

#accordion {width: 590px;}
.accordionTitle {padding:7px;}
.accordionButton {width: 590px;height: 39px;background:url(images/global/accordion.png) no-repeat;color: #ffffff;font-family: Arial, sans-serif;font-weight: bold;font-size:14px;border-bottom: 1px solid #FFFFFF;cursor: pointer;}
.accordionContent {width: 580px;padding-top:15px;padding-left:10px;background: #fff;font-family: Arial, sans-serif;font-size:12px;}
.active {background: url(images/global/accordion.png) 0px -78px no-repeat;color: #ffffff;}
.highlight{background: url(images/global/accordion.png) 0px -39px no-repeat;color: #ffffff;}

.slider_arrow_left {bottom: 10px; cursor: pointer !important; float: left; height: 22px; left: 10px; position: absolute; width: 22px; z-index: 5;}
.slider_arrow_left {background: url(images/slider/left_arrow.png) no-repeat top left;}
.slider_arrow_right {bottom: 10px; cursor: pointer; float: left; height: 22px; left: 37px; position: absolute; width: 22px; z-index: 5;}
.slider_arrow_right {background: url(images/slider/right_arrow.png) no-repeat top left;}
.slider_selector, .slider_selector_dis {bottom: 10px; list-style: none; margin: 0 0 0 5px; position: absolute; right: 45px; z-index: 5;}
.slider_selector li, .slider_selector_dis li {display: block !important; background: url(images/slider/slider_selector.png) no-repeat top left; cursor: pointer; float: left; margin: 0 3px !important; height: 10px !important; position: relative !important; width: 10px !important;}
.slider_selector li.current, .slider_selector_dis li.current {background: url(images/slider/slider_selector_current.png) no-repeat top left;}
.slider_selector_dis li {cursor: default !important;z-index: 5;}
.container {float: left; position: relative; margin-left:20px; width: 100%; z-index: 15;}
	
#slider-content{width:960px; margin:0 auto;}
#slider, #slider li {width: 960px; height: 300px;}
#slider {list-style: none !important;float: left;margin: 0 !important;padding: 0 !important;overflow: hidden !important;position: relative !important;}
#slider li {display: none;float: left;margin: 0;position: absolute;width: 100%;}
#slider li.current {display: block;z-index: 2 !important;}
#slider li.next {display: block;z-index: 1 !important;}
#slider li ul li {display: block !important;position: relative !important;}

#button-deskray {width: 203px;}

#button-deskray a.button-deskray {display: block; width: 196px; height: 48px; background-image: url(images/dicomray/deskray-demo.png); background-position: top; }
#button-deskray a.button-deskray:hover {background-position: bottom; }

#nav {background: url(images/global/navigation.gif);height: 43px;width: 960px;margin: 0px auto;position: relative;margin-top:10px; margin-bottom: 10px;}
#nav li {list-style-type: none;float: left;}
#nav a {height: 43px;display: block;}
#nav span {display: none;}

#one{ width: 45px; }
#two { width: 67px; }
#three { width: 136px; }
#four { width: 122px; }
#five { width: 121px; }
#six { width: 115px; }
#seven { width: 130px; }
#eight { width: 145px; }
#nine { width: 79px; }

#one a:hover {background: url(images/global/navigation.gif) 0px -43px no-repeat;}
#two a:hover {background: url(images/global/navigation.gif) -45px -43px no-repeat;}
#three a:hover {background: url(images/global/navigation.gif) -112px -43px no-repeat;}
#four a:hover {background: url(images/global/navigation.gif) -248px -43px no-repeat;}
#five a:hover {background: url(images/global/navigation.gif) -370px -43px no-repeat;}
#six a:hover {background: url(images/global/navigation.gif) -491px -43px no-repeat;}
#seven a:hover {background: url(images/global/navigation.gif) -606px -43px no-repeat;}
#eight a:hover {background: url(images/global/navigation.gif) -736px -43px no-repeat;}
#nine a:hover {background: url(images/global/navigation.gif) -881px -43px no-repeat;}

/* Created by Jonathan S. West, Last Modified on January 24 2012 */
